Re: [Swftools-common] New info -- Was: Problems with avi2swf

From: Amartyo Banerjee
Subject: Re: [Swftools-common] New info -- Was: Problems with avi2swf
Date: Tue, 18 Nov 2003 10:54:15 -0800 (PST)

> Found it, thanks! 

Glad to have helped.

> It seems avi2swf crashes if the video file doesn't have any audio
> streams to be converted.
> Strange that no one (including me) ever tried that before. :)
> Anyway, it should be fixed now in the current CVS version.

I just downloaded the latest version. There is no crash anymore.
But, when I do 'avi2swf 30sec.avi', this is the output I get:
<init> : Avifile CVS-0.7.39-031007-11:59-gcc version 3.2 (Mandrake Linux 9.0 
<init> : Available CPU flags: fpu vme de pse tsc msr pae mce cx8 apic sep mtrr 
e mca cmov pat pse36 clflush dts acpi mmx fxsr sse sse2 ss ht tm
<init> : 1900.06 MHz Intel(R) Pentium(R) 4 CPU 1.90GHz processor detected
<reader> : checking: 30sec.avi
<AVI reader> : MainHeader: MicroSecPerFrame=40000 MaxBytesPerSec=25000
 PaddingGranularity=0 Flags=[ HAS_INDEX IS_INTERLEAVED TRUST_CKTYPE ] 
 InitialFrames=0 Streams=1 SuggestedBufferSize=1048576 WxH=352x288
 Scale=0 Rate=0 Start=0 Length=0
<AVI reader> : StreamHeader: Type=vids Handler=DIVX Flags=[ ]
 InitialFrames=0 Scale=1 Rate=25 Start=0 Length=750
 SuggestedBufferSize=1048576 Quality=-1 SampleSize=0 Rect l,r,t,b=0,352,0,288
<AVI reader> : Reading index from offset: 1041184
<AVI reader> : Stream 0 vids : DIVX (0x58564944) 750 chunks (2.93KB)
<StreamCache> : Creating cache for file descriptor: 4
<reader> : Initialized video stream (chunk tblsz: 750, fmtsz: 40)
Couldn't open video stream
<LDT keeper> : Installed fs segment: 0x40013000
<codec keeper> : Found 11 plugins (/usr/local/lib/avifile-0.7,A:41,V:84)
<XviD plugin> : XviD linux decoder
<codec keeper> : XviD video decoder created

<CImage> : Cannot convert non-YUV image to BGR24
Converting frame 0

Is avi2swf only meant to work with avi files that don't contain any audio ?
Would it help if I posted another gdb session ?

Thanks for all the trouble, and sorry for asking so many questions :)

